Energy Storage and Electric Vehicles: Technology, Operation, Challenges, and Cost-Benefit Analysis

Abstract: With ever-increasing oil prices and concerns for the natural environment, there is a fast-growing interest in electric vehicles (EVs) and renewable energy resources (RERs), and they play an important role in a gradual transition. However, energy storage is the weak point of EVs that delays their progress. The world's EV industry is accelerating to faster adoption with appropriate incentives to the EV owners, policy support, and encouraging local manufacturing.
